Versatile, playful and a little edgy, Istasia Sew keeps her looks interesting with strong silhouettes, texture and plenty of chunky silver jewellery
A scroll through Istasia Sew’s Instagram and you know she’s a Fendi girl. Her style is hard to pin down, moving between black, strong silhouettes, interesting textures and the occasional more experimental look. There’s one thing that seems to make its way into almost every outfit, though: chunky silver jewellery. For Sew, it’s the finishing touch.
“I would say that my style is very versatile, I wear whatever I like,” she says. The looks she feels most herself in are experimental but comfortable, with plenty of texture and structure. And when it comes to her style icon, there’s no hesitation: her mum. “She is the person who sculpted my view in fashion and polished the way I present myself.”
